			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Speaking at a town hall in Green Bay Wisconsin, President Barack Obama addressed head on what is the hot debate of the day: whether a health reform overhaul <a href="http://www.huffingtonpost.com/2009/06/11/american-medical-associat_n_214132.html">should include a public option for health insurance</a>.</p>
<p>&#8220;I also strongly believe that one of the options in the exchange should be a public insurance option,&#8221; Obama declared, in what was one of his most forceful statements of support since the health care debate began. &#8220;And the reason is not because we want a government takeover of health care. I&#8217;ve already said, if you&#8217;ve got a private plan that works for you, that&#8217;s great. But we want some competition. If the private insurance companies have to compete with a public option, it will keep them honest and it will help keep their prices down.&#8221;</p>
<p>The remarks came <a href="http://www.huffingtonpost.com/2009/06/11/american-medical-associat_n_214132.html">just several hours after the American Medical Association</a> said it would oppose a public option for coverage. 			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Sens. Joseph Lieberman (I-Conn.) and Lindsey Graham (R-S.C.) lambasted transparency advocates at a press conference Tuesday, when they renewed their promise to bring Senate business to a halt until their bill blocking the release of detainee photographs becomes law.<span id="more-7204"></span></p>
<p>&#8220;We&#8217;re not going to do any more business in the Senate,&#8221; Graham said, his face flushed red. &#8220;Nothing&#8217;s going forward until we get this right.&#8221;</p>
<p>The duo&#8217;s bill, which would allow the Pentagon to exempt Bush-era photos from the Freedom of Information Act, was stripped from the conference version of the war supplemental Monday night. In anticipation of trouble, Lieberman and Graham had already inserted the bill into the tobacco-regulatory legislation currently on the floor of the Senate.</p>
<p>By turns sober and furious, the two senators vowed again Tuesday to vote against &#8212; and, if possible, filibuster &#8212; the troop-funding bill and all other legislation until they get their way. They equated the weapons supplied by the war supplemental spending bill with detainee photos that they said would serve as a recruiting tool for al-Qaida and a weapon against U.S. troops.</p>
<p>&#8220;If these photos see the light of day, it will be a death sentence to some serving abroad,&#8221; Graham said. The removal of the photo amendment, he said, &#8220;is one of the most outrageous and irresponsible acts in the history of the Congress.&#8221; He said the initial response to the Abu Ghraib scandal was necessary and the punishments meted out were appropriate.</p>
<p>Lieberman, for his part, dismissed release of the photos as &#8220;sheer voyeurism&#8221; and &#8220;disclosure without a purpose.&#8221; The Detainee Treatment Act and the Military Commissions Act, Lieberman said, are ample enough evidence that the system has been sufficiently reformed.</p>
<p>&#8220;Transparency in government is an American value, but it is not without limits, no more than any of the values embraced in our Constitution,&#8221; Lieberman said. &#8220;The transparency in this case is needless and dangerous transparency.&#8221;</p>
<p>Graham said there is consensus among many senators, military officials and diplomats about the need to pass the bill. Even the White House is in support, he said, and helped them draft the bill, remaining supportive of it in conference. <p><!--endclickprintexclude-->Vice President Joe Biden on Monday is presenting to President Obama the &#8220;Roadmap to Recovery,&#8221; a plan to accelerate the implementation of the $787 billion stimulus plan in its second 100 days.</p>
<p>Obama signed into law the American Recovery and Reinvestment Act in February, vowing the program would create or save 3.5 million jobs. So far, 150,000 jobs have been saved or created by the plan &#8212; fewer than that 345,000 jobs lost in May alone.</p>
<p>The White House says as a result of the expedited pace, the recovery plan will create or save more than 600,000 jobs in the second 100 days. But House Republicans, who never supported the <a class="cnnInlineTopic" href="http://topics.cnn.com/topics/Economic_Stimulus">stimulus</a>, are saying, &#8220;I told you so.&#8221;</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Officials say top Democrats in the House are circulating health care proposals that would require individuals to purchase insurance if they can afford it and slap an unspecified financial penalty on those who refuse.</p>
<p>These officials _ both Democrats and others briefed _ also say top lawmakers in the House are considering imposing a new tax on certain health insurance benefits as one of numerous options to help pay for expanding coverage to the uninsured. No details are available, and these officials stressed that no final decisions have been made.<span id="more-7194"></span></p>
<p>The sources spoke on condition of anonymity, saying they did not want to pre-empt a presentation set for Tuesday for members of the House Democratic rank and file.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><a href="http://www.politico.com/news/stories/0609/23262.html" target="_blank">Gay rights</a> campaigners, most of them Democrats who supported Obama in November, have begun to voice their public frustration with Obama’s inaction, small jokes at their community’s expense and deafening silence on what they see as the signal civil rights issue of this era.<span id="more-7171"></span></p>
<p>His most important campaign promises repealing the <a href="http://www.politico.com/news/stories/0608/11450.html" target="_blank">Defense of Marriage Act</a> and the military ban on openly gay and lesbian service-members have not been fulfilled.</p>
<p>And the news, which emerged quietly earlier this year, that he’d supported same-sex marriage back in 1996, then changed his mind, especially rankles. As mainstream Democratic politicians such as Sen. <a href="http://www.politico.com/news/stories/0609/23298.html" target="_blank">Chuck Schumer</a> (D-N.Y.) move to support same-sex marriage, gay rights advocates say that the barrier-breaking president looks increasingly odd for opposing what they see as full equality.</p>
<p>“Obama is out of step with his party, which is overwhelmingly in <a id="KonaLink1" class="kLink" style="text-decoration: underline ! important; position: static;" href="http://www.politico.com/news/stories/0609/23328.html#" target="undefined"><span style="color: #004276 ! important; font-weight: 400; font-size: 13.0167px; position: static;"><span class="kLink" style="color: #004276 ! important; font-family: Arial,Helvetica,sans-serif; font-weight: 400; font-size: 13.0167px; position: static;">favor</span></span></a> of marriage at this stage,” said David Mixner, a veteran gay rights activist who is among the organizers of a march on Washington for same-sex marriage scheduled for this fall. “He’s out of step with the next generation.”</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Mrs. Obama told students at a high school graduation that Sotomayor is &#8220;more than ready&#8221; to be a justice and compared the judge&#8217;s life story of humble beginnings and high achievement to the paths taken by her husband and herself.</p>
<p>Sotomayor, who grew up in a New York City housing project and went on to Princeton and Yale universities, &#8220;says she still looks over her shoulder and wonders if she measures up,&#8221; Mrs. Obama said at Howard University, chiming in on Sotomayor&#8217;s behalf as her husband began a Mideast trip.<span id="more-7173"></span></p>
<p>It was a subtle but pointed counter to Republicans who have cited Sotomayor&#8217;s speeches and writings about how her background affects her work as a judge to question whether she would let her personal biases interfere with her judicial decisions.</p>
<p>Hours earlier, Gingrich told supporters in a letter that he shouldn&#8217;t have called Sotomayor a racist, adding that the word had been &#8220;perhaps too strong and direct.&#8221; But he said the 2001 speech that prompted his remark, in which Sotomayor said she hoped the rulings of a &#8220;wise Latina&#8221; would be better than those of a white male without similar experiences, was still unacceptable.</p>
<p>Gingrich conceded that Sotomayor&#8217;s rulings have &#8220;shown more caution and moderation&#8221; than her speeches and writings, but he said the 2001 comments &#8220;reveal a betrayal of a fundamental principle of the American system _ that everyone is equal before the law.&#8221;</p>
<p>Sotomayor, 54, would be the first Hispanic and the third woman to serve on the high court.</p>
<p>Gingrich&#8217;s comments and similar ones by radio host Rush Limbaugh _ who on Wednesday said Sotomayor would bring &#8220;racism&#8221; and &#8220;bigotry&#8221; to the court _ have enraged Sotomayor&#8217;s backers and caused problems for GOP figures who have been pushing to bring more diversity to the party.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Reactions to Obama&#8217;s speech addressing the Muslim world in Cairo, Egypt, Thursday were prompt and disparate, covering the gamut between laudatory and derogatory. A spokesman for Palestinian President Mahmoud Abbas, with whom Obama met last week, described the speech as &#8220;a good start and an important step towards a new American policy,&#8221; <a href="http://in.reuters.com/article/worldNews/idINIndia-40092520090604">according to Reuters</a>, however Israeli Prime Minister Benjamin Netanyahu has so far been notably silent.  <a href="http://www.upi.com/Top_News/2009/06/04/Israeli-response-to-Obama-speech-divided/UPI-23651244119593/">And according to UPI,</a> the reaction within Israel to Obama&#8217;s speech was &#8216;divided&#8217;:<span id="more-7179"></span><br />

<blockquote><p>Analysts on Israeli television stations criticized the American president for failing to mention the word terror in his speech even once, opting instead to use violence. While the professionalism and conviction Obama delivered his speech was praised by some Israeli officials, others felt the president&#8217;s reference to the Holocaust followed by a direct passage where he spoke of the suffering and humiliation of the Palestinian people was hurtful and unnecessary.</p></blockquote>
<p>The speech is reported to have been well received within Cairo itself, <a href="http://www.washingtonpost.com/wp-dyn/content/article/2009/06/04/AR2009060401729.html">according to the <em>Washington Post</em>:</a></p>
<blockquote><p>The fact that Barack Obama chose Egypt as the location for Thursday&#8217;s address to the Muslim world endeared him to the locals, who are always proud to host a foreigner and even prouder when it shows off their history.</p></blockquote>
<p>Representing a more cynical, but predictable viewpoint is Iran&#8217;s Supreme Leader Ayatollah Ali Khamenei, who issued a statement Thursday to say that it will take much more than &#8220;words, speech and slogan&#8221; to repair America&#8217;s &#8220;ugly, detested and rough&#8221; image, <a href="http://www.jpost.com/servlet/Satellite?cid=1244034995385&amp;pagename=JPost/JPArticle/ShowFull">according to the AP.</a></p>
<p>Likewise, a spokesman for Hamas&#8217; leader in Gaza, Ayman Taha, relayed similarly unimpressed sentiments, describing the approach laid out in the speech as &#8220;no different from the policy of his predecessor, George W. Bush,&#8221; <a href="http://news.bbc.co.uk/2/hi/middle_east/8083171.stm">the BBC reports.</a></p>
